    Analysis Of Factors Determining Factors Of Financial Performance In Tourism Industry Companies In Indonesia

    Since the Covid-19 pandemic, tourism industry companies have experienced losses to bankruptcy. However, in 2022, after the reopening of entertainment and tourism locations, the financial performance of the tourism industry has begun to improve until now. But not all tourism industry companies feel the same way, in fact they are still experiencing losses until now. This can be seen from the value of the company's financial performance as proxied by ROA which is still below the average company health standard of 5.98%. Therefore, the purpose of this study is to analyze the determining factors that influence the financial performance of the tourism industry, namely lavarege, firm size or capital structure. The number of research populations is 30 companies, then reduced using purposive sampling to 24 companies with a 4-year research period (2020-2023). This study uses panel data linear regression analysis which is tested using Eviews 14 software. Then, the researcher also conducted a bankruptcy risk analysis on each company. The results of the study indicate that leverage and firm size are determining factors for financial performance, while capital structure is not a determining factor for financial performance in tourism sector companies listed on the IDX in 2020-2023. Then, the results of the determination coefficient show that the research variables used (leverage, firm size and capital structure) have an influence of only 32.3%. And based on the results of the bankruptcy risk analysis, 4 companies were found to be in the "Financial Distress" category, namely PT Citra Putra Realty Tbk, PT Dafam Property Indonesia Tbk, PT Hotel Fitra International Tbk and PT Pembangunan Graha Lestari Indah Tbk

    Market Penetration As A Proposed Marketing Strategy: Case Of PT. Atourin Teknologi Nusantara

    Indonesia’s tourism industry has great potential for economic growth, driven by its natural and cultural richness and the increasing adoption of digital platforms, which are increasingly being introduced. As one of the players in the industry, PT Atourin Teknologi Nusantara (Atourin) faces challenges in increasing brand awareness and attracting travelers to use their services, which offer a variety of local attractions. This study aims to identify Atourin’s target market, explore the factors influencing brand awareness and purchase intention, and propose effective marketing strategies to increase Atourin’s presence. A mixed methodology with qualitative and quantitative approaches was conducted, combining interviews and questionnaire distribution. Data analysis used clustering to group the identified market segment, then findings of external and internal analysis using SWOT, TOWS matrix, and Ansoff matrix. Based on the findings, it is known that Atourin, as a technology-based startup in the tourism industry, certainly has strengths in the field of tourism technology and knowledge. Unfortunately, the level of awareness of the Atourin brand in the local tourist market is still low. This study recommends market penetration that focus on increasing market share with existing products in existing markets through the use of social media, increasing customer retention through loyalty programs, and strategic collaborations to strengthen Atourin’s market position and drive business growth in Indonesia’s digital tourism industry

    The Influence Of Liquidity, Company Growth And Capital Structure On Company Value With Profitability As A Moderating Variable In Property & Real Estate Companies Listed On The Indonesia Stock Exchange In 2019 – 2023

    This research aims to analyze the effect of liquidity, company growth, and capital structure on firm value with profitability as a moderating variable in Property and Real Estate compan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ange in 2019 - 2023. The research method uses MRA (Moderated Regression Analysis) with quantitative data processed through the application Eviews13 software. The results of this study indicate that Liquidity has a significant positive effect on Company Value. Company Growth does not affect Company Value. Capital Structure has a significant positive effect on Company Value. Profitability cannot moderate the effect of Liquidity on Company Value. Profitability cannot moderate the effect of Growth on Company Value. Profitability can moderate the effect of Capital Structure on Company Value. The implications of this research are that investors are expected to be more careful in choosing stocks to invest in, in addition, management can create strong financial stability, can implement an effective asset management system to manage assets optimally, can consider the optimal balance between debt and equity, and can identify and reduce inefficient costs

    Faktor-Faktor Yang Berhubungan Dengan Kejadian Hipertensi Di Puskesmas Pasar Ikan Kota Bengkulu

    Hypertension is defined as systolic and diastolic blood pressure measurements that continuously exceed normal values. The prevalence of hypertension in Indonesia based on measurements of the population aged 18 years is 34.1%. Hypertension occurs in the 31-44 year age group at 31.6%, around 45.3% at the age of 45-54 years, and at the age of 55-64 years 55.2%. The aim of the research is to determine the risk factors for the incidence of hypertension at the Pasar Ikan Health Center in Bengkulu City in 2024. This research method is quantitative with a cross sectional design. The sample in this study amounted to 71 people, taken by accidental sampling. Data were processed using univariate and bivariate analysis with the chi-square test. The results of the research results of statistical tests showed that there was a significant relationship between the incidence of hypertension and age (p=0.001), showed that there was a relationship between obesity and the incidence of hypertension (p=0.001), showed that there was no significant relationship between stress and the incidence of hypertension (p=0.344 ). The suggestion is that the community health center can optimize preventive and promotive programs regarding factors related to the incidence of hypertension and it is hoped that hypertension sufferers will reduce their consumption of factors related to the incidence of hypertension and carry out regular check-ups at the Pasar Ikan Community Health Center

    Analysis Of Factors Associated With Gout Arthritis At The Bantal Health Centre, Muko-Muko Regency

    Gouty arthritis is an inflammation of the joints. WHO data in 2022, shows the prevalence of gouty arthritis in the world is 41.2%. Riskesdas data on the prevalence of gouty arthritis in Indonesia has increased by 11.9%. Cases of gouty arthritis from the Mukomuko Health Office data in 2022 were 248 cases. The aim of the study was to determine the factors associated with the incidence of Gout Arthritis at the Bantal Health Centre, Mukomuko Regency. This research is a quantitative research using cross sectional study design. The number of samples in the study were 78 respondents. The sampling technique used accidental sampling. The analysis used was univariate and bivariate analysis with chi-square test. The results showed that almost half of the respondents suffered from Gouty Arthritis by 38.5%, most of the respondents had an age < 60 years as many as 57 respondents (73.1%), most of the respondents were female as many as 56 respondents (71.8%), almost all of the respondents had BMI ≤ 25 as many as 65 respondents (83.3%), there was a significant relationship between age (p = 0.000), gender (p = 0.000) with the incidence of gouty arthritis, there was no significant relationship between nutritional status and the incidence of gouty arthritis at Puskesmas Bantal, Mukomuko Regency (p = 0.118). It is hoped that further research can look at other risk factors using a more in-depth research design and analysis
